Why Buhari sacked his Chief Security Officer

President Muhammadu Buhari has terminated the appointment of his Chief Security Officer, Abdulrahman Mani.

Mani was fired on Saturday, July 4, due to a supremacy battle he had with the Aide-de-Camp to the President, Lt.-Col. Lawal Abubakar.

The ADC, had a couple of weeks ago, issued a memo redeploying officials of the Department of State Security from their beats inside the Presidential Villa, as part of efforts to enhance general security within the villa.

But Mani would counter his directive by issuing a rejoinder dated June 26, where he directed the DSS officials to disregard the ADC’s order.

After a bit of back and forth, the Aide-de-Camp to the President would have his way and the DSS officials were eventually redeployed.

The termination of Mani was reportedly carried out on the President’s order by acting Director-General of the Department of State Service, Lawan Daura.

Mani who was redeployed to Ebonyi State has been replaced with Bashir Abubakar as the new Chief Security Officer.
